Transaction 8529dfc391ac903dde2ccd738d06ab77d92a5f9656e8d0dd98e191e961cca6e2

2 Input
2 Outputs
  • 8529dfc391ac903dde2ccd738d06ab77d92a5f9656e8d0dd98e191e961cca6e2:0
  • value  595575
    address  16FGQWk1xnZn7nzfARrW8d8j3qsXtQVZDZ
  • 8529dfc391ac903dde2ccd738d06ab77d92a5f9656e8d0dd98e191e961cca6e2:1
  • value  2073459
    address  3LTyAJtKMtsy3M7Z39cbTyyT4zijP7BqH5